Rollie Helmling's New Job
It was announced that Rollie Helmling will be the new Motorsports Development Director for the Indiana Economic Development Corporation. It will be interesting to see how he does in this position.

This is interesting. The other day the Gov. was in town for a dedication of a new building of a customer of mine. This customer happens to build parts for many different race car parts. When the Gov. was made aware of this, he talked about the Idiana ED starting a new roll in helping Indiana advance ever further in the auto racing industy in Indiana and that an annoucement would be made of a new hire that came from USAC. What impressed me was his knowledge of the grass roots racing in Indiana with the sprints and midgets, and also the Brownsburg area being a hub for this. I think if his words are true and they let Rollie do his job, this could be a very good thing for grass roots racing in Indiana.
